Blog

What Makes a Superstar Data Architect

Every job title associated with big data is in high demand these days and command enviable paychecks. But when enterprises spend, they want to be sure that they g ...

What’s the Best Startup City in the American Midwest?

The American Midwest is increasingly becoming the home of technology startups. But how do Midwestern cities stack up against each other?

To fin ...

Is Ruby on Rails Still Worth Learning in 2017 and Beyond?

Choosing the right programming language isn’t about what’s trendy at the moment, it’s more about what you’re trying to achieve. But no matter what language you de ...

How to Become a Better Software Team Lead

Becoming a software team leader can be a challenging transition even for a seasoned developer. This is primarily because you will only use part of your skills and ...

What Will Developers Do When AI Takes Their Jobs or Reduces Their Pay in the Future?

The term ‘artificial intelligence’ (AI) was first coined by John McCarthy, a computer scientist, way back in 1955. He strongly believed that each and every aspect ...

In-House vs Outsourced Development: Why More Isn't Always Better

It’s better to have a good remote developer rather than a bad local one. At the same time, a great remote developer will be better than a good local one. Regardle ...

How Startups Can Protect Their IP and Avoid Legal Issues

This is a reprint of my article published originally in LinkedIn Pulse and featured in Entrepreneurship.  As a startupper, you don’t live in an isolated world; you meet with ...

How to Improve Team Collaboration in a Distributed Environment

Technology has changed the way we think, live, and work. Companies are no longer bound by any single time zone or location. Furthermore, orders and responses have also moved fr ...

How To Hire For The Right Big Data Skills

The continuing growth of Big Data has created a demand for job candidates with specific skills in data science and software engineering. Hiring for the right set ...

Should Early Stage Startups Hire Developers In-House or Outsource their Project to a Third-Party?

Hiring a developer for a project can be a difficult process because of a major shortage in top talent. For startups about to move from idea to development, choosing between hir ...

How to Use Machine Learning to Hire the Best IT Talent

Today, more businesses are embarking on IT staffing and are ready to spend huge budgets on hiring the most appropriate and competent IT personnel. Because competition for human ...

How to Cultivate Homegrown Senior Tech Talent

These days, we spend a lot of time on developing effective ways to manage millennials, but now we need to take it up a notch. It’s critical to do it now because w ...

To DevOps or Not To DevOps: Expert Opinions

Modern agenda requires that software developers significantly shorten their development processes across all stages from ideation to release. More and more customers want their ...

How to Develop an Effective Agile Talent Management Strategy

Not long ago, it was very easy for corporate giants to attract the best talent across a variety of industries. It was a simple process because everyone dreamed of ...

How to Plan Software Development Resources Against Project Budget

In order to maximize your project(s) profitability, ensure your software development team has the right capacity to execute project and better manage overtime work, you need to ...

Staffing Tips For Bootstrapping Startups

Bootstrapping your startup doesn’t necessarily mean a lonely existence, in spite of the image that comes with the word. Starting a business without a pile of cash ...

Get a Quote